However, I don't think keeping the original £3.5k grant is possible - I think that's based on date of registering the actual vehicle so it would be whatever it does or doesn't qualify for today? I'm speculating a bit but seems to make sense to me.
It's not based on the registration of the vehicle it's based on the order from an individual and Tesla having submitted it on the OLEV system with the government which is normally done a few days after all of the information requested at the time of order is submitted.
